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]\sqrt{x+3}+4=5[/tex]

subtract 4 from each side

[tex]\sqrt{x+3} +4-4=5-4[/tex]

square both sides

[tex]\sqrt{x+3}^2=1^2[/tex]

so we have

[tex]x+3=1[/tex]

subtract 3 from each side

[tex]x+3-3=1-3[/tex]

so our answer is [tex]x=-2[/tex]

Testing:

H0:μ=54.5

H1:μ<54.5

Your sample consists of 48 subjects, with a mean of 54.1 and standard deviation of 1.8.

Calculate the test statistic, rounded to 2 decimal places.

t=

Answers

Answer:

t = -1.54.

Step-by-step explanation:

The test statistic is:

[tex]t = \frac{X - \mu}{\frac{\sigma}{\sqrt{n}}}[/tex]

In which X is the sample mean, [tex]\mu[/tex] is the value tested at the null hypothesis, [tex]\sigma[/tex] is the standard deviation and n is the size of the sample.

H0:μ=54.5

This means that [tex]\mu = 54.5[/tex]

Your sample consists of 48 subjects, with a mean of 54.1 and standard deviation of 1.8.

This means, respectively, that [tex]n = 48, \mu = 54.1, \sigma = 1.8[/tex]

Test statistic

[tex]t = \frac{X - \mu}{\frac{\sigma}{\sqrt{n}}}[/tex]

[tex]t = \frac{54.1 - 54.5}{\frac{1.8}{\sqrt{48}}}[/tex]

[tex]t = -1.54[/tex]

The test statistic is t = -1.54.
